Rail service Internet suspended five killed in shopian encounter

Authorities have suspended rail service and Internet in south kashmir on saturday morning following a gunfight at kilora village of shopian. Army spokesman has been quoted saying that five bodies of militants were recovered from the debris of encounter site. Clashes and protests were going on in the area till reports last reached here.

Encounter rages in Sopore

Government forces today started cordon and search operation in Behrampora Sopore after having credible inputs about the presence of militants in the village. Police said that when government forces were laying the cordon militants fired upon them triggering intense gunfight in the area. More details are awaited.
